The Backyard Scientist asks:

Has anybody else noticed you can ‘break’ persistence of vision? For example, if you look at a really fast moving object, like a spinning tire, or ceiling fan it looks blurred, but if you dart your eyes away from it, or towards it you can see a single ‘frame’ of the action?

Nicolai replies with a possible answer:

That is called Chronostasis I believe. This is also why the first second, when moving your eyes to look at a clock, can seem to take slightly longer. Really interesting effect for sure!
